My Hero Academia Season 8 Release Date – My Hero Academia is a manga series created by Khei Horikoshi that has taken the world by storm since its first publication in 2014. It’s a story about a population where almost everyone has superpowers, and the protagonist, Izuku Midoriya, aims to become the number one hero in a world where being a hero is the ultimate goal. The illustrations in the manga are exceptional, and the anime series adaptation, produced by Bones, is equally impressive.
